The Douglas squirrels are also known as pine squirrels and chickarees.  They are one of the smallest squirrels in their range.  They are a reddish or a brownish-grey and chestnut brown on their backs.  They have a white or very light orange belly and a black lateral line that runs down their sides.

Their bodies measure 12 inches length and about 6 inches in tail length.  Their hind feet are 45-60 mm and they weight about a half of a pound.  The Douglas squirrels have a summer and winter coat that molt twice each year.  In the spring the molt begins in September, but the tail only molts once a year in the summer.
